S&P 500   3,894.16 (-0.20%)
DOW   31,526.77 (-0.03%)
QQQ   322.67 (-0.28%)
AAPL   126.85 (-0.74%)
MSFT   235.40 (-0.65%)
FB   265.53 (+0.23%)
GOOGL   2,070.23 (+0.03%)
TSLA   709.91 (-1.19%)
AMZN   3,147.00 (+0.03%)
NVDA   549.82 (-0.70%)
BABA   240.05 (-0.68%)
CGC   35.08 (+1.01%)
GE   13.04 (-0.53%)
MU   94.28 (-0.51%)
NIO   45.94 (-7.68%)
AMD   86.06 (-0.38%)
T   28.29 (+0.71%)
F   11.99 (+0.08%)
ACB   11.48 (+3.99%)
DIS   197.65 (+1.37%)
BA   223.07 (-0.59%)
NFLX   550.62 (+0.00%)
BAC   35.83 (+0.11%)
S&P 500   3,894.16 (-0.20%)
DOW   31,526.77 (-0.03%)
QQQ   322.67 (-0.28%)
AAPL   126.85 (-0.74%)
MSFT   235.40 (-0.65%)
FB   265.53 (+0.23%)
GOOGL   2,070.23 (+0.03%)
TSLA   709.91 (-1.19%)
AMZN   3,147.00 (+0.03%)
NVDA   549.82 (-0.70%)
BABA   240.05 (-0.68%)
CGC   35.08 (+1.01%)
GE   13.04 (-0.53%)
MU   94.28 (-0.51%)
NIO   45.94 (-7.68%)
AMD   86.06 (-0.38%)
T   28.29 (+0.71%)
F   11.99 (+0.08%)
ACB   11.48 (+3.99%)
DIS   197.65 (+1.37%)
BA   223.07 (-0.59%)
NFLX   550.62 (+0.00%)
BAC   35.83 (+0.11%)
S&P 500   3,894.16 (-0.20%)
DOW   31,526.77 (-0.03%)
QQQ   322.67 (-0.28%)
AAPL   126.85 (-0.74%)
MSFT   235.40 (-0.65%)
FB   265.53 (+0.23%)
GOOGL   2,070.23 (+0.03%)
TSLA   709.91 (-1.19%)
AMZN   3,147.00 (+0.03%)
NVDA   549.82 (-0.70%)
BABA   240.05 (-0.68%)
CGC   35.08 (+1.01%)
GE   13.04 (-0.53%)
MU   94.28 (-0.51%)
NIO   45.94 (-7.68%)
AMD   86.06 (-0.38%)
T   28.29 (+0.71%)
F   11.99 (+0.08%)
ACB   11.48 (+3.99%)
DIS   197.65 (+1.37%)
BA   223.07 (-0.59%)
NFLX   550.62 (+0.00%)
BAC   35.83 (+0.11%)
S&P 500   3,894.16 (-0.20%)
DOW   31,526.77 (-0.03%)
QQQ   322.67 (-0.28%)
AAPL   126.85 (-0.74%)
MSFT   235.40 (-0.65%)
FB   265.53 (+0.23%)
GOOGL   2,070.23 (+0.03%)
TSLA   709.91 (-1.19%)
AMZN   3,147.00 (+0.03%)
NVDA   549.82 (-0.70%)
BABA   240.05 (-0.68%)
CGC   35.08 (+1.01%)
GE   13.04 (-0.53%)
MU   94.28 (-0.51%)
NIO   45.94 (-7.68%)
AMD   86.06 (-0.38%)
T   28.29 (+0.71%)
F   11.99 (+0.08%)
ACB   11.48 (+3.99%)
DIS   197.65 (+1.37%)
BA   223.07 (-0.59%)
NFLX   550.62 (+0.00%)
BAC   35.83 (+0.11%)
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 Consolidated EdisonE.OnPG&EWEC Energy GroupAmeren
SymbolNYSE:EDOTCMKTS:EONGYNYSE:PCGNYSE:WECNYSE:AEE
Price Information
Current Price$66.85$10.22$10.99$82.32$71.42
52 Week RangeHoldHoldBuyHoldBuy
MarketRank™
Overall Score2.61.41.51.82.4
Analysis Score2.90.03.32.02.3
Community Score1.51.92.42.02.0
Dividend Score5.02.50.01.73.3
Ownership Score1.70.01.71.71.7
Earnings & Valuation Score1.92.50.01.92.5
Analyst Ratings
Consensus RecommendationHoldHoldBuyHoldBuy
Consensus Price Target$76.12N/A$14.18$94.20$86.00
% Upside from Price Target13.86% upsideN/A29.04% upside14.43% upside20.41% upside
Trade Information
Market Cap$22.96 billion$22.15 billion$21.77 billion$26.11 billion$18.11 billion
Beta0.110.361.30.180.19
Average Volume2,798,69863,77012,975,4921,457,5361,715,984
Sales & Book Value
Annual Revenue$12.57 billion$45.93 billion$17.13 billion$7.52 billion$5.91 billion
Price / Sales1.820.481.273.453.06
Cashflow$9.02 per share$1.97 per share$9.16 per share$5.36 per share$7.53 per share
Price / Cash7.415.201.2015.379.49
Book Value$54.79 per share$6.76 per share$10.18 per share$32.41 per share$33.33 per share
Price / Book1.221.511.082.542.14
Profitability
Net Income$1.34 billion$1.75 billion$-7,642,000,000.00$1.14 billion$828 million
EPS$4.37$0.75$3.93$3.58$3.35
Trailing P/E Ratio16.5513.63N/A22.2520.88
Forward P/E Ratio14.9912.6210.9920.5818.94
P/E Growth7.802.214.834.513.76
Net Margins11.06%0.61%-27.77%16.26%14.70%
Return on Equity (ROE)7.77%12.32%21.57%11.36%10.17%
Return on Assets (ROA)2.43%1.29%2.06%3.37%2.86%
Dividend
Annual Payout$3.10$0.38N/A$2.71$2.06
Dividend Yield4.64%3.72%N/A3.29%2.88%
Three-Year Dividend Growth10.87%N/AN/A21.63%12.52%
Payout Ratio70.94%50.67%N/A75.70%61.49%
Years of Consecutive Dividend Growth47 YearsN/AN/A1 Years7 Years
Debt
Debt-to-Equity Ratio1.03%3.46%1.72%1.02%1.18%
Current Ratio0.59%0.81%0.74%0.49%0.76%
Quick Ratio0.54%0.75%0.69%0.36%0.49%
Ownership Information
Institutional Ownership Percentage62.44%0.09%70.10%73.05%75.46%
Insider Ownership Percentage0.18%N/A0.14%0.31%0.51%
Miscellaneous
Employees14,89073,22923,0007,5009,183
Shares Outstanding342.42 million2.17 billion1.98 billion315.44 million253.36 million
Next Earnings Date5/6/2021 (Estimated)3/24/2021 (Estimated)5/7/2021 (Estimated)5/3/2021 (Estimated)5/10/2021 (Estimated)
OptionableOptionableNot OptionableOptionableOpt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.